Question:
If a buyer purchase three vacant lots in a HOA subdivision, can said buyer and Village/City agree that buyer can build a single family house across two lots when the HOA Board of Directors
Disagree?
– Hardy
Answer:
Hi Hardy,
Homeowners associations generally have the authority to regulate such matters. Check your HOA’s governing documents to understand your HOA’s powers. If the CC&Rs give the HOA the authority to deny such a request, then the HOA can do so. The exception is if city or local laws specify that an HOA may not regulate this.
